Megan Fox and Machine Gun Kelly appear to be rebuilding their relationship as they spend significant time together following the arrival of their daughter, Saga Blade, in March 2024. Although the couple has not officially labeled their relationship, they are reportedly acting “like a couple” while co-parenting their child.
According to an insider who spoke to PEOPLE, the pair has been spending “pretty much every night” at Fox’s home with their baby. The source noted, “They’re together often, but he’s going on tour soon. He spends pretty much every night at her house with the baby, and they act like a couple, but they haven’t put a label on it or made anything official.”
Despite their previous engagement, which was announced in January 2022 and called off in March 2024, the couple is embracing their roles as parents. The insider emphasized that Fox is pleased with how Machine Gun Kelly, whose real name is Colson Baker, has stepped up for both her and their daughter. “They’re putting the baby first, and it’s brought them closer in many ways,” the source added.
In a recent appearance on *The Jennifer Hudson Show*, Machine Gun Kelly praised Fox, stating, “It truly was an epic story of love, pain and a lot of magic.” He expressed his admiration, saying, “I had it with a person who is the greatest partner, the greatest partner to have had a child with.” He also shared a light-hearted moment, discussing how their daughter changes in appearance, mentioning, “Last month, she looked exactly like me and now she looks exactly like her.”
The musician, 35, also has a 16-year-old daughter, Casie, from a previous relationship. Fox, 39, has three children—Noah, 12, Bodhi, 11, and Journey, 9—from her marriage to Brian Austin Green. Machine Gun Kelly has indicated that his parenting “specialty” revolves around introducing music and laughter into their lives.
He shared with PEOPLE, “I recently wrote her a lullaby on a ukulele. Megan is in the no sleep club, for sure. I’ve been travelling a little bit, just doing some performances.” He added, “Women are in the rougher trenches of the newborn process, but my specialty is music and laughs and whatever I can do to make her smile and kind of get introduced to the world with love.”
